What are the financing options for development projects in the engineering and construction services sector in the Dominican Republic?

Development projects in the engineering and construction services sector in the Dominican Republic can access financing through commercial banks, private investors, government infrastructure support programs, and alliances with international engineering and construction companies. These financings are intended for civil works construction projects, structural engineering, electrical and mechanical engineering projects, and construction services in general.

What is the right to freedom of thought and expression in El Salvador?

The right to freedom of thought and expression in El Salvador implies that all people have the right to express their ideas, opinions and thoughts freely and without censorship. This includes the right to freedom of expression, the right to seek, receive and disseminate information, the right to criticism and public debate, and the right to protection against censorship and repression by the State.

Is it possible to request a duplicate identity card in Costa Rica if the original was lost or stolen?

Yes, you can request a duplicate ID card in Costa Rica if the original was lost or stolen. You must file a complaint with the corresponding authorities and then go to the Civil Registry to request the duplicate, following the established procedures.
